Với tất cả các phương tiện có sẵn trên Internet và bộ sưu tập các thư viện và hình ảnh kỹ thuật số, tất cả chúng ta đều có vấn đề khi chúng ta muốn đổi tên một loạt các tệp để chúng dễ tiếp cận hơn với tên phát âm hoặc tên có ý nghĩa. Đổi tên một loạt các tập tin một không chỉ bực bội mà còn là một nhiệm vụ tốn thời gian. Xem xét thực tế này, Microsoft từ lâu đã giới thiệu một tính năng đổi tên hàng loạt trong Windows Explorer giúp bạn đổi tên nhiều tập tin cùng một lúc.

Chắc chắn bạn có thể sử dụng các công cụ của bên thứ ba để đổi tên các tệp, nhưng thường những công cụ này có nhiều tính năng gây nhầm lẫn cho người dùng trung bình và bạn không muốn cài đặt phần mềm khác chỉ để đổi tên một số tệp.

Sử dụng Windows Explorer

Sử dụng Windows explorer để đổi tên hàng loạt tập tin trong Windows có lẽ là cách dễ nhất. Để đổi tên hàng loạt các tập tin, chỉ cần chọn tất cả các tập tin bạn muốn đổi tên, nhấn nút F2 (cách khác, nhấp chuột phải và chọn đổi tên) và sau đó nhập tên bạn muốn và nhấn nút enter.

Hành động trên là lấy tên tệp bạn chỉ định và thêm số vào mỗi tên tệp. Như bạn có thể thấy từ hình ảnh bên trên và bên dưới, tôi đã đổi tên các tệp từ “test (*). Html” thành “file (*). Html”.

Dễ dàng đổi tên tệp bằng Windows explorer, nhưng phương pháp này chỉ là cơ bản và không linh hoạt, ví dụ: bạn không thể thay đổi đuôi tệp (.html) và không thể hạn chế hoặc thay đổi Windows khi thêm số, v.v., chúng ta cần sử dụng dấu nhắc lệnh và Windows Powershell.

Sử dụng Command Prompt

Đổi tên tập tin batch bằng cách sử dụng dấu nhắc lệnh Windows là linh hoạt hơn nhiều, và điều tốt về cách sử dụng phương pháp này là bạn cũng có thể thay đổi phần mở rộng của những tập tin đó. Trước hết, chúng ta hãy xem cách đổi tên các tập tin batch mà không thay đổi phần mở rộng.

1. Mở thư mục chứa các tập tin được đổi tên. Ở đây bấm vào File và trên "mở dấu nhắc lệnh."

2. Hành động trên sẽ mở dấu nhắc lệnh ở vị trí mong muốn. Bây giờ hãy nhập lệnh sau để đổi tên hàng loạt các tệp. Đừng quên thay thế "tập tin" với tên tập tin hiện tại và "tên" với tên bạn muốn. Vì chúng tôi đang sử dụng ký tự đại diện nên bạn không cần phải nhập tên tệp đầy đủ.

 ren tệp * .html name * .html 

Khi bạn đã thực hiện lệnh, tất cả các tệp được đổi tên thành tên mới và trong khi vẫn giữ nguyên các phần mở rộng. Nếu bạn muốn thay đổi hàng loạt các phần mở rộng (ví dụ html thành txt), thì hãy sử dụng lệnh sau đây.

 ren * .html * .txt 

Lệnh trên sẽ đổi tên tất cả các tệp có phần mở rộng .html trong thư mục thành phần mở rộng .txt.

Sử dụng Windows Powershell

Windows Powershell mạnh hơn nhiều so với dấu nhắc lệnh thông thường và cũng dễ sử dụng. Để đổi tên hàng loạt tập tin bằng Powershell, chúng ta cần sử dụng hai lệnh, tức là DIR và Rename-Item. Bây giờ để đổi tên hàng loạt mà không thay đổi phần mở rộng của họ, nhấn nút WIN, gõ "powershell" và nhấn nút Enter để mở Powershell.

Khi Windows Powershell được mở, hãy điều hướng đến thư mục bạn muốn bằng lệnh CD. Đối với tôi, tôi đang điều hướng đến D: \ mte \ vì đây là nơi chứa các tệp của tôi.

Một khi bạn đang ở trong vị trí, sử dụng lệnh dưới đây. Trong khi sử dụng lệnh, đừng quên thay đổi "TestName" thành tên tập tin bạn muốn.

 dir | % {$ x = 0} {Đổi tên mục $ _ -NewName "TestName $ x.html"; $ x ++} 

Lệnh trên là nó sẽ lấy tất cả các tệp trong thư mục bằng lệnh DIR và chuyển đến lệnh “ Rename-Item ” để đổi tên tất cả các tệp thành “TestName *.” Ở đây * biểu thị các số và các số đó được phân bổ đệ quy sử dụng “$ x.”

Bây giờ nếu bạn muốn thay đổi phần mở rộng của tất cả các tệp trong một thư mục, hãy sử dụng lệnh dưới đây.

 Get-ChildItem * .html | Đổi tên-Mục -NewName {$ _. Tên -địa chỉ '\ .html', '. Txt'} 

Lệnh trên là lấy tất cả các tệp có phần mở rộng .html trong một thư mục và thay đổi chúng thành .txt.

Để biết thêm về lệnh Rename-Item, hãy đọc tài liệu của Microsoft để biết thêm các định nghĩa và ví dụ.

Bạn thích phương pháp nào trong số ba phương pháp trên? Chắc chắn, Powershell có thể được áp đảo cho người mới bắt đầu nhưng nó là thú vị để làm việc với một khi bạn đã đạt được một số kinh nghiệm.

Hy vọng rằng sẽ giúp, nhưng làm chia sẻ suy nghĩ của bạn và các phương pháp khác của các tập tin đổi tên hàng loạt bằng tay.